Enhanced medication safety with AI

Medication safety and optimization are emerging as critical frontiers for responsible AI adoption. Medi‑Span® Expert AI introduces AI‑ready, expert‑curated drug data designed for developers building next‑generation digital health applications, from agentic prescription workflows to adverse event monitoring. By delivering medication intelligence through a Model Context Protocol (MCP), the solution accelerates innovation while ensuring drug information remains accurate, consistent, and clinically governed. These capabilities support pharmacists, clinicians, and health tech teams seeking to modernize medication management with automation that enhances — rather than replaces — clinical judgment.

Featured healthcare solutions leveraging AI

Use cases for Artificial Intelligence (AI) in healthcare continue to be uncovered as machine learning models ingest more data and information. When used properly, the power of AI lies in its ability to parse through large amounts of data and uncover trends that can be addressed by care providers. From connecting what some would consider irrelevant data points to alert care providers about a patient's increased risk of sepsis to ensuring auto-generated patient education information arrives at the right moment, AI can significantly improve patient outcomes while reducing costs for providers and payers.
